Chen, Hsinchun; Dhar, Vasant – Information Processing and Management, 1991
Two studies of the cognitive processes involved in online document-based information retrieval were conducted. These studies led to the development of five computational models of online document retrieval which were incorporated into the design of an "intelligent" document-based retrieval system. Vaughan, Misha Walker; Dillon, Andrew – Proceedings of the ASIS Annual Meeting, 1998
Explores the utility of the intersection of genre theory and cognitive psychology in providing a meaningful framework for analysis and design purposes. Reports results of research into the elements of genre that influence users of digital documents and provides examples of the usefulness of this analysis in Web-based environments. (Author/AEF)
